Community Activist Bennie Swans To Lead Horry Democrats

The Horry County Democratic Party elected Bennie Swans of Carolina Forest its new county chair on Saturday afternoon, passed 18 resolutions, and elected its slate of officers as well as delegates to the South Carolina Democratic Party Convention in Columbia on April 30. Democrats Will Unite To Keep The White House

South Carolina Democrats overwhelmingly supported Secretary Hillary Clinton in the presidential primary on February 27.  While Senator Bernie Sanders earned more votes proportionately in Horry, York, Charleston and Greenville than in other counties across the state (he lost 2:1 in these counties versus at least 3:1 elsewhere), the Clinton campaign momentum was unstoppable. Horry Democrats to Elect Officers and Delegates on Saturday, March 19

The Horry County Democratic Party will hold its County Convention on Saturday, March 19, 2016.
